Definition

A town is a relatively small and populated urban area, typically smaller than a city, often characterized by a close-knit community and local amenities.

Sample Sentences

  1. The small town was known for its charming cobblestone streets and friendly locals.
  2. After years of living in the city, she decided to move back to her hometown for a quieter life.
  3. Every summer, the town hosts a festival that attracts visitors from all over the region.
  4. The mayor announced plans for new parks and improvements to make the town more appealing.
  5. Walking through the town square, he admired the historic buildings that had stood for centuries.
